Output 95d6b5743f6538e88ab2422023f20d2a66d5e1b54baaf67921eb05fcf35c8ff9:1

value
1480680
script pubkey
OP_0 OP_PUSHBYTES_20 58ab00a49ee5f620b91dc3589613028a37a8b416
address
bc1qtz4spfy7uhmzpwgacdvfvycz3gm63dqku8e93t
transaction
95d6b5743f6538e88ab2422023f20d2a66d5e1b54baaf67921eb05fcf35c8ff9